WebCross-pollination within a species (this may be inter- varietal) is called xenogamy. Cross-pollination involving different strains of plants yields hybrids. WebLastly, pea plants can self-pollinate or cross-pollinate or be artificially pollinated. The pea flower contains both female and male parts (named carpel and stamen, respectively), and thus pea plants are said to be hermaphrodite. ...
